With the Bruins I had a hard time putting them there, every time you bet against the Bruins they do even better than the year before. I just think the injuries they have (best forward and best defenseman) is going to be hard to replace that production.
With Ottawa I think they did a good job this offseason and have the goaltending depth to do well without Talbot plus their young guys are only going to get better.
The Devils have an amazing top 6 which was reinforced with Palat, they are going to have a full year with Hamilton who was finished top 10 in Norris 2/3 past years. Also no chance they have as bad goaltending luck as they did last year (they used 7!!!!)
The Rangers have a sick team with the best goalie and their young guys (Laf, Kappo, Miller, Fox, Schneider) are only going to get better (a lot better). They also have superstar pieces
The Wild was a team I might regret putting into the finals but they have an elite goaltender who put up okay numbers on a terrible Blackhawks team and was good on the Wild. Plus Kaprizov will take a leap, and they have great depth on both forward and D

Don’t get me wrong, its the bruins two best players. That’s going to hurt, particularly with mcavoy. But what are they going to miss? 15 games? Maybe 20? I think they can tread water for that stretch given the depth. The top six still looks pretty good, and having lindholm back there to anchor the D will certainly help things.

Ottawa’s off-season was incredible. No argument there. I still think they’re a year away though.

The devils on the other hand…ya, i don’t see it. An amazing top six? Hughes is awesome, but I certainly worry about injuries with him. Hischier is good, but I think I would wait for him to have a season north of 60 points before thinking of him as an amazing top six center. Then there’s Palat who is certainly a good second liner, and Brett who had a breakout year. But beyond that, what are we calling amazing? Who’s got the better top six, boston with the injury to marchand, or jersey?

I’m not a fan of their blue line at all. I’m not a fan of dougie, and think he has massive holes in his game. I think it’s kind of telling that teams generally seem to get better once he’s off the roster.
Then there’s the goaltending, the biggest issue. The devils chose to address that problem by taking a backup goalie from another team that had really bad goaltending.

I just can’t see the devils making any sort of a jump forward that would have them sniffing the playoffs.

I still think they’re one very big piece away: that all situation true #1 D.

I get what you mean but I’m really not worried about that as 5 out of 6 Devils D can excel in big minutes at 5v5.
Marino and Siegenthaler are playing among the league’s best in a defensive capacity, Hamilton is still one of the most gifted offensive defenders in the league.
Besides, could be that the Devils have future all situations guy in Nemec.

On the whole I believe that the Devils D corps are their overall strongest department, ahead of both the Forwards and Goalies.
I just hope they can keep it up and that there’s a playoff appearance at the end of it.
